Hello I am going to build a plasterboard wall extension (see diagram) to a solid wall and need to know how much depth to leave for a plasterer to do a skim and blend in the plaster to the existing solid wall. Can anyone help please?
 
2-3mm on top of the 12.5mm plasterboard - just sand/polish until it blends in.

that is assuming the existing is uniform and level.
